Matija Dobric Eliminated in 5th Place ($2,250,000)

Niveau 42 : Blinds 1,500,000/3,000,000, 3,000,000 ante
Matija Dobric
Matija Dobric

Hand #168: Matija Dobric raised to 6,000,000 as the first player to act and Espen Jorstad took the better part of two minutes before three-betting to 21,000,000 in the small blind. The four-bet shove of Dobric came within a minute, and Jorstad asked for an exact count before he made the call.

Both sides of the rail went on their feet as the cards were revealed.

Matija Dobric: {6-Diamonds}{6-Clubs}
Espen Jorstad: {a-Clubs}{q-Spades}

The {k-Hearts}{q-Clubs}{7-Clubs} flop propelled Jorstad into the lead and that didn't change on the {10-Diamonds} turn either. Another blank followed on the {8-Clubs} river and that sent Dobric to the rail in fifth place while Jorstad soared to the top of the leaderboard.

Dobric's rail kept chanting the first name of the Croatian for several moments before their favorite headed to the bustout interview.

Hand #39: Eames Doubles Through Duek With Cowboys

Niveau 39 : Blinds 1,000,000/1,500,000, 1,500,000 ante
John Eames
John Eames

Hand #39: Michael Duek raised to 3,000,000 and John Eames three-bet to 8,500,000 from the hijack. Duek spent over two minutes in the tank and asked Eames how much he was playing before moving all in.

Eames snap-called for his last 42,100,000.

John Eames: {k-Hearts}{k-Clubs}
Michael Duek: {9-Spades}{9-Clubs}

The flop came {q-Clubs}{q-Diamonds}{j-Diamonds} and the turn was the {2-Hearts}. The river {2-Diamonds} secured the double for Eames who now sits second in chips behind Dobric.

Meanwhile, Eames' rail went berserk chanting "Shoes off, if you love John Eames."

Asher Conniff Eliminated in 10th Place ($675,000)

Niveau 38 : Blinds 600,000/1,200,000, 1,200,000 ante
Asher Conniff
Asher Conniff

Hand #7: Asher Conniff open-jammed in a middling position for 17,700,000 and it folded to Michael Duek in the small blind, who made the call. The rails jumped out of their seats and the chants commenced as one of the most typical coin flips got under the way.

Asher Conniff: {10-Hearts}{10-Diamonds}
Michael Duek: {a-Hearts}{k-Hearts}

Once the {k-Clubs}{k-Spades}{k-Diamonds} flop gave Duek quads, his rail from Argentina exploded while the recent birthday boy was already drawing dead. Neither the {4-Diamonds} turn nor the {6-Diamonds} river were important anymore as the elimination of Conniff in 10th place for $675,000 and the 2022 WSOP Main Event has reached the official nine-handed final table.

"Definitely the coolest poker experience I've ever had," he told Kara Scott shortly after his exit. "It was an unfortunate way to go out but at least they put me out quickly. I appreciate every moment though.

"It's been amazing, incredible, especially today. So many people showed up. It was special."
